To convert from the rectangular to the polar form, we use the following rectangular coordinates to polar coordinates formulas: r = √(x² y²) θ = arctan(y x) where: x and y — rectangular coordinates; r — radius of the polar coordinate; and. θ — angle of the polar coordinate, usually in radians or degrees. with these results, we. There may be many ways to visualize the conversion of polar to rectangular coordinates. sometimes (depending upon the values of #r# or #theta#) it is easier or faster to see this conversion graphically or in some other form, but in the end it comes back to the relationship between #x, y, r, and theta# as defined by the trigonometric functions. How to: given polar coordinates, convert to rectangular coordinates. given the polar coordinate (r, θ), write x = rcosθ and y = rsinθ. evaluate cosθ and sinθ. multiply cosθ by r to find the x coordinate of the rectangular form. multiply sinθ by r to find the y coordinate of the rectangular form.
